The aim of this investigation is to study the mechanism of spontaneous infiltration of AlSi alloys into porous graphite with emphasis on the role of the reaction of carbide formation in the infiltration process. Results are obtained using the sessile drop technique that enables the variation of the infiltration depth with time to be monitored in situ. In addition to the infiltration data, this method provides quantitative information on wetting thus allowing the values of wetting and infiltration rates measured in the same experiment to be compared.
